What does Kothari Petroche do?

06-Jun-2025

Kothari Petrochemicals Ltd is a micro-cap manufacturer of Poly Iso Butylene (PIB), with net sales of ₹153 Cr and a net profit of ₹17 Cr for the quarter ending March 2025. The company has a market cap of ₹999 Cr and key metrics include a P/E of 15.00 and a return on equity of 21.50%.

Overview:<BR>Kothari Petrochemicals Ltd is a manufacturer of Poly Iso Butylene (PIB) in the petrochemicals industry, classified as a micro-cap company.<BR><BR>History:<BR>Incorporated in April 1989, Kothari Petrochemicals Ltd acquired the entire share capital of KPL HK, making it a wholly owned subsidiary. How has been the historical performance of Kothari Petroche?

13-Nov-2025

Kothari Petroche has shown steady growth in net sales and profitability, with net sales reaching 577.34 Cr in Mar'25 and profit after tax increasing to 65.82 Cr from 39.18 Cr in Mar'23. However, the operating profit margin decreased slightly from 15.93% in Mar'24 to 13.9% in Mar'25, indicating a need for cost management.

Answer:<BR>The historical performance of Kothari Petroche shows a steady growth in net sales and profit over the years, with net sales reaching 577.34 Cr in Mar'25, a slight decrease from 603.14 Cr in Mar'24 but significantly higher than 482.15 Cr in Mar'23. The total operating income followed a similar trend, peaking at 577.34 Cr in Mar'25. The company has seen an increase in operating profit (PBDIT) from 63.35 Cr in Mar'23 to 91.72 Cr in Mar'25, although it was higher at 104.31 Cr in Mar'24. Profit before tax also increased from 55.21 Cr in Mar'23 to 82.21 Cr in Mar'25, with profit after tax rising to 65.82 Cr in Mar'25 from 39.18 Cr in Mar'23. The earnings per share (EPS) improved from 6.62 in Mar'23 to 11.12 in Mar'25, reflecting a positive trend in profitability. However, the operating profit margin decreased slightly from 15.93% in Mar'24 to 13.9% in Mar'25. The company's total expenditure, excluding depreciation, was 497.11 Cr in Mar'25, showing an increase from 425.23 Cr in Mar'23. <BR><BR>Breakdown:<BR>Kothari Petroche's financial performance over the years indicates a consistent upward trajectory in sales and profitability, with net sales climbing from 226.84 Cr in Mar'21 to 577.34 Cr in Mar'25. The operating profit margin has fluctuated, peaking at 15.93% in Mar'24 before dropping to 13.9% in Mar'25. Despite this, the operating profit (PBDIT) has shown significant growth, reaching 91.72 Cr in Mar'25 from 63.35 Cr in Mar'23. Profit before tax also experienced a notable increase, moving from 55.21 Cr in Mar'23 to 82.21 Cr in Mar'25, while profit after tax rose to 65.82 Cr in Mar'25. The earnings per share have improved markedly, reflecting the company's enhanced profitability. Overall, Kothari Petroche has demonstrated strong financial growth, although the slight decrease in operating profit margin suggests a need for careful management of costs moving forward.

About Kothari Petrochemicals Ltd stock-summary
stock-summary
Kothari Petrochemicals Ltd
Micro Cap
Petrochemicals
Kothari Petrochemicals Limited (KPL), incorporated in April, 1989 is the manufacturer of Poly Iso Butylene (PIB), with the capacity of 24000 tones per annum. This accounts for 90% of the total production in the country. During the period 2016-17, the Company acquired the entire share capital of KPL HK held by KPL SG and thereby KPL HK has become the wholly owned subsidiary of the Company.
